Top Outdoor Porcelain Tile Trends for 2026
Large-Format Patio Tiles
Bigger tiles are becoming incredibly popular in luxury outdoor design. Large-format porcelain creates a cleaner, less cluttered appearance because there are fewer grout lines. This minimalist look works beautifully for cafés, hotel terraces, rooftop lounges, and modern villas.
Interestingly, many architects say large-format tiles also create the illusion of wider outdoor spaces. That matters quite a bit for urban properties where every square foot counts.
Stone-Inspired Textures
Natural stone aesthetics remain timeless, but real stone can be expensive and difficult to maintain. Porcelain alternatives now replicate limestone, slate, travertine, and granite so realistically that many visitors cannot tell the difference at first glance.
This trend is especially strong in commercial patio flooring because businesses want elegance without unpredictable maintenance costs.
Wood-Look Outdoor Tiles
Wood-inspired porcelain flooring continues gaining attention in 2026. It delivers the warm, organic appearance of timber without concerns about termites, moisture damage, or fading under direct sunlight.
For restaurants and hospitality brands, this creates a welcoming atmosphere while maintaining durability in high-traffic environments.
Outdoor Tile Colors Dominating 2026
Color trends are shifting toward earthy and calming palettes. Designers are moving away from overly glossy or artificial tones and embracing more natural shades.
Most Popular Shades Include:
- Warm beige and sand finishes
- Concrete grey textures
- Charcoal matte surfaces
- Soft terracotta-inspired tones
- Natural wood hues
These colors blend seamlessly with landscaping, modern furniture, and outdoor lighting systems. They also photograph exceptionally well — something many commercial property owners now consider for social media branding.

FAQs About Outdoor Porcelain Tiles
Are outdoor porcelain tiles suitable for hot climates?
Yes. High-quality porcelain tiles are designed to handle extreme temperatures, making them ideal for hot and humid regions.
Do porcelain patio tiles become slippery when wet?
Most outdoor porcelain collections include anti-slip surfaces specifically designed for patios, pool decks, and commercial walkways.
How long do outdoor porcelain tiles last?
With proper installation, premium porcelain tiles can last for decades with minimal maintenance.
Are large-format outdoor tiles difficult to maintain?
Not really. In fact, fewer grout lines often make cleaning easier compared to smaller tile layouts.
